• Spousal Grief and Bereavement Support Group – Are you experiencing grief due to the death of your spouse? Please join us on Tuesday nights, 7:00-8:30 p.m. at St. Peter’s Parish Hall, Upper Gullies. This support group provides an opportunity for individuals to meet and discuss the loss of your spouse, provide support to each other, and share information that may help during the grieving process. This support group is “drop in” and supported by Grief and Bereavement Services, Eastern Health. For more information please call 631-9539 or 777-8972.
